Akira Ishida (石田 彰, Ishida Akira, born November 2, 1967) is a Japanese actor and voice actor. He was a part of Mausu Promotion (formerly known as Ezaki Production, until its 1990 change of name) from 1988 until March 2009, when he moved to Peerless Gerbera.[1] For his portrayal of Saki Abdusha in You're Under Arrest, Setsuna Aoki in Sakura Wars and Athrun Zala in Gundam SEED & Gundam Seed Destiny, he was chosen as the most popular voice actor in the Animage Anime Grand Prix in 2004,[3] and won the Best Supporting Character (male) award at the first Seiyu Awards in 2007.[4]
